โ€ข Inclusive Education Policies: An examination of national and international policies promoting education access and inclusion for all students, including those with special needs. Discussion on the importance of policy implementation and monitoring.
โ€ข Accessibility in Educational Spaces: Exploration of physical and digital accessibility in schools, universities, and other educational settings. Analysis of architectural and technological solutions that ensure equal access to education for all students.
โ€ข Teacher Training on Inclusion: A review of teacher training programs that prioritize inclusive education practices, with a focus on creating supportive learning environments for diverse learners.
โ€ข Assistive Technologies: Overview of various assistive technologies that support learning for students with disabilities, including text-to-speech software, communication devices, and adaptive keyboards.
โ€ข Differentiated Instruction: Strategies for designing and delivering lessons that cater to the unique learning needs and styles of all students, including those with special needs or learning challenges.
โ€ข Universal Design for Learning (UDL): Introduction to UDL principles and their application in designing inclusive curriculums, assessments, and classroom environments.
โ€ข Collaborative Partnerships: Examination of partnerships between educators, families, and community organizations in promoting access to and success in education for all students.
โ€ข Inclusive Assessment Practices: An exploration of assessment strategies that accommodate diverse learning needs and abilities, while maintaining academic integrity and rigor.
โ€ข Culturally Responsive Teaching: Examination of culturally responsive teaching practices that recognize and value the unique cultural backgrounds and experiences of all students.
